1/** 2 * @test /nodynamiccopyright/ 3 * @bug 5012028 6384539 4 * @summary javac crash when declare an annotation type illegally 5 *
| 1/** 2 * @test /nodynamiccopyright/ 3 * @bug 5012028 6384539 4 * @summary javac crash when declare an annotation type illegally 5 *
|
6 * @compile/fail IllegalAnnotation.java 7 * @compile/fail/ref=IllegalAnnotation.out -XDdev -XDrawDiagnostics IllegalAnnotation.java
| 6 * @compile/fail/ref=IllegalAnnotation.out -XDrawDiagnostics IllegalAnnotation.java
|
8 */ 9class IllegalAnnotation { 10 { 11 @interface SomeAnnotation { } 12 } 13}
| 7 */ 8class IllegalAnnotation { 9 { 10 @interface SomeAnnotation { } 11 } 12}
|